Pazo de Raxoi is a stunning neoclassical building in Santiago de Compostela, serving as the city hall and a must-visit tourist attraction. With its grand architecture and historical significance, it offers visitors a glimpse into the city's rich heritage and vibrant culture.

Getting There
-
Walking
If you are in the city center, head towards the historic area. Locate the Cathedral of Santiago de Compostela, which is a prominent landmark. Once you are facing the Cathedral, turn to your right and walk towards Praza do Obradoiro. The Pazo de Raxoi is situated directly across from the Cathedral, facing the square.
-
Public Transport
If you are further away from the center, you can take a local bus that stops at 'Praza de Galicia' or 'Praza de Abastos'. From either of these stops, it's a short walk to Praza do Obradoiro. Head towards the Cathedral, and the Pazo de Raxoi will be directly across from it in the square.
